Darnholt Slimmer strips build toolchains, shells, and package managers from final images, producing distroless-style layers for the Verrow platform. Attack surface drops accordingly: no interpreter, no curl, no writable package db.

The slimmer walks the dependency graph from declared entrypoints and removes everything unreachable, subject to size and retention thresholds. False-positive removals fail closed at build time, never at runtime.

Reviewers should validate the threshold choices below. Current tuning constants:

tuning table, yajog-yahof:
BUDGETS = {
    "lamvan": 303,
    "wenox": 460,
    "fenvan": 525,
}

## Deployment

Deploying Allocatron, our experiment assignment service, is a two-step rollout: canary to the Northbay cluster, then full fleet. The release manager should verify assignment checksums match between canary and baseline before promoting. Rollbacks reuse the previous salt version automatically, so no assignments shift. Each deploy reads its settings at startup from the values below.

service settings:
PRAWYN_PIN=9848
PRAWYN_METRICS_HOST=metrics.prawyn.lumicworks.corp
PRAWYN_LOG_LEVEL=warn
PRAWYN_TENANT=pelius

Runbook: Perchline API pagination fixes

Reviewer notes: cursor-based pagination replaced page offsets in v3. Verify `next_cursor` is opaque and base64, never sequential. Rate limits apply per cursor walk, so the pager daemon must authenticate as a service account rather than anonymously. Restart order: pager, then gateway. Before restarting, edit /etc/perchline/pager.env and add the service credential on the following line.

sealed setting: ARCHIVE_KEY3=8d0